Abstract

The present study aims at analyzing the level of exposure to non-ionizing radiation for the population inside central residential area of Craiova, Romania This type of EM (electromagnetic radiation) is generated mainly by GSM (Global System for Mobile Communication) technology of wireless communication based on the electromagnetic emitters (GSM antennas) needed for covering wider territorial areas. They produce constant pulsed microwave radiation even when nobody is using the phone, affecting the people inside and outside public and residential buildings. Contributions in this filed show that there is a direct link between continuous exposure to microwave radiation from cell phone towers and serious health problems over the years. The paper is based on selective measurements of HF radiations within GSM 900-1800MHz range at cell towers and at distance both inside and outside residential buildings within the study area. In most cases the exposure zones were located in the vicinity of base stations antenna where recorded levels of HF radiation were superior to recommended values. One main objective is to establish some residential compliance exposure zones inside the study area in relation with international regulations and standards concerning GSM radiation limits.
